引言
随着互联网的发展,网络安全和隐私保护变得越来越重要。V2Ray是一款优秀的代理工具,可以有效帮助用户绕过网络限制,提高上网的安全性和匿名性。本文将详细介绍如何在DigitalOcean上安装和配置V2Ray。
什么是DigitalOcean?
DigitalOcean是一个为开发者提供简易的云计算平台。通过DigitalOcean,用户可以快速创建和管理虚拟服务器,适用于各种需求,包括网站托管、应用程序开发等。它以其高性价比和友好的用户界面而受到广泛欢迎。
V2Ray简介
V2Ray是一个开源的网络代理工具,主要用于实现科学上网。它的主要特点包括:
- 多协议支持:支持VMess、VLESS、Shadowsocks等协议。
- 灵活的路由功能:可以根据目标地址选择不同的传输方式。
- 强大的安全性:使用TLS加密,确保数据安全。
在DigitalOcean上创建VPS
1. 注册DigitalOcean账号
在开始之前,用户需要先注册一个DigitalOcean的账号。访问DigitalOcean官网并完成注册过程。
2. 创建Droplet
- 登录后,点击“Create”按钮,然后选择“Droplets”。
- 选择你需要的操作系统(推荐使用Ubuntu 20.04或更高版本)。
- 选择合适的内存、CPU和存储配置,通常1GB RAM足够。
- 设置数据中心位置,尽量选择离你较近的地点。
- 设置SSH密钥以保证安全访问。
- 点击“Create Droplet”完成创建。
在DigitalOcean上安装V2Ray
1. SSH连接到你的Droplet
使用SSH工具连接到你的Droplet,例如: bash ssh root@你的Droplet_IP地址
2. 更新系统
在安装V2Ray之前,建议更新系统软件包: bash apt update && apt upgrade -y
3. 安装V2Ray
可以使用以下命令安装V2Ray: bash bash <(curl -s -L https://git.io/v2ray.sh)
此命令会自动下载并安装最新版本的V2Ray。
4. 配置V2Ray
安装完成后,你需要配置V2Ray。配置文件通常位于/etc/v2ray/config.json
,可以使用vim或nano编辑: bash nano /etc/v2ray/config.json
- 在配置文件中,可以设置你的UUID,并调整其他相关参数。
- 保存并退出编辑器。
5. 启动V2Ray服务
使用以下命令启动V2Ray服务: bash systemctl start v2ray
- 为确保V2Ray在重启后自动启动,执行: bash systemctl enable v2ray
常见问题解答(FAQ)
V2Ray可以在Windows上使用吗?
是的,V2Ray支持多个平台,包括Windows、Linux和macOS。用户可以下载相应的客户端,并按照说明进行配置。
如何找到我的UUID?
UUID通常在配置文件中指定,如果没有,你可以通过以下命令生成: bash cat /proc/sys/kernel/random/uuid
V2Ray的速度怎么样?
V2Ray的速度取决于网络环境和配置。合理配置和选择合适的服务器位置可以提高速度。
V2Ray与Shadowsocks有什么区别?
V2Ray功能更为强大,支持更多协议和更复杂的路由策略,而Shadowsocks相对简单,适合一般的科学上网需求。
如何排查V2Ray连接问题?
可以通过查看V2Ray的日志文件来排查问题,通常日志位于/var/log/v2ray/access.log
和/var/log/v2ray/error.log
。
总结
通过以上步骤,你已经成功在DigitalOcean上安装和配置了V2Ray。无论是提升网络安全性,还是保护隐私,V2Ray都能为你提供有效的解决方案。希望这篇文章能够帮助你顺利完成配置,享受安全上网的体验。